Effective presence in local and international market due to effective use of internet and
global conditions.
Good market presence due to the support of younger generation regarding facilitation of
internet facilities.
Healthy balance sheet along with strong financials and cash flow from operations.
Numerous number of product and service offerings.
Providence of strong customer experience through focusing over delivering great product
and services (Doh, Luthans and Slocum, 2016).
Weaknesses
High rate of carbon emission due to the continues nature of business operations
Largely dependent in UK market and have limited presence in the high growth Asia
pacific region.
Separation of Openreach from BT will result in loss of branding and marketing image.
Opportunities
The digital agenda policy of UK provides the opportunity an organisation regarding
promotion of their services with speed network.
The Good relation of UK with neighbouring countries provide the opportunities to British
telecom that enlarge their trade link.
To expand more an organisation must focus over implementation of innovative
technology along with grabbing opportunities exist in new markets.
Focus over adoption of 6G services as this will provide the opportunity to gain more
strategic edge in competitive market place.
The organisation also has the opportunity to use the cloud of cloud services for the
purpose of ensuing high economies of scale (Fabus, 2018).
Focus over the implementation of 100% renewable energy to meet environmental targets
Threats
High level of competition in market
Presence of large number of competitors that has negative impact over the market
presence and business operations of British Telecom.
Impact of Brexit and the subsequent devaluation of British pound that has diminishing
impact over profitability.

Impact of the drivers on the two of the firm’s functional areas
The above mentioned factors or drivers also have the impact over the functional areas of BT.
The impact will be ascertained on both manners positive and negative. This totally depend over
the nature of factor or driver. There were many drivers identified in PESTLE of both positive
and negative nature. The impact of these upon two functional areas i.e. HRM and Operations of
BT are presented below:
Operation: BT has worldwide operations. The emission of carbon due to the business
operations is high within an environment (Gooris and Peeters, 2016). The impact of this has
negative over the business of BT because society is more concerned about the safety of
environment. This resultant into decrement in market image along with market base. In this
regard, the organisation must focus over the adopt of measures that help to remove negative
environmental impact. But, the same will also lower down the profit margin along with
productivity level of employees. On the other hand, the effective control of BT over the internet
service is prove as major factor towards the success in market. This perfectly help in attraction of
potential new consumers towards the consumption of their services in market against to the
competitors.
HRM: This department of an organisation has work related to the planning of workforce.
It has the responsibility regarding the hiring of personnel’s who are competent for the post and
completion of the organisational objectives. The presence of legal requirements regarding
employment brings an obligation over this department must ensure about the fulfilment of all
rules and regulation at all different nations otherwise they have to face the negative
consequences and penalties. This has direct negative impact where image of an organisation start
diminishes in market along customer base (Kasemsap, 2018). On the other hand, the level of
completion is also high in market so this department must ensure about the training, performance
appraisal, and motivation of staff members. This will work in the direction of improving their
productivity along engagement within an organisational activity.
